Vitiligo is a skin condition that causes patches of pale white skin. Over time the light patches of skin may increase in size and/or spread to other areas of the body. Hypopigmentation, also known as skin depigmentation, is the loss of the skin’s color due to disease or trauma to the skin. It is identified by pale spots on the skin and is more noticeable in people with darker skins because of the color distinction between the patches and their skins.
